Abstract: A method for integrating test modules in a modular test system includes creating component categories for integrating vendor-supplied test modules and creating a calibration and diagnostics (C&D) framework for establishing a standard interface between the vendor-supplied test modules and the modular test system, where the C&D framework comprises interface classes communicating vendor-supplied module integration information. The method further includes receiving a vendor-supplied test module, retrieving module integration information from the vendor-supplied test module in accordance with the component categories, and integrating the vendor-supplied test module into the modular test system based on the module integration information using the C&D framework.

Abstract: A method for communicating test information from a source to a destination is disclosed. The method includes providing a modular test system, where the modular test system comprises a system controller for controlling at least one site controller, the at least one site controller for controlling at least one test module. The method further includes providing a datalog framework for supporting extension of user-defined datalog formats, providing support classes for supporting user-initiated datalog events, receiving a datalog event requesting for communicating input test information from the source to the destination, configuring output test information based upon the destination, the datalog framework and the support classes, and transferring the output test information to the destination.
Abstract: A method and device for authenticating a MS has an R-UIM by using CAVE Algorithm are provided. The hardware structure of the device includes a cdma2000/HRPD dual-mode chip, a User Identity Module supporting the CAVE algorithm. The dual-mode terminal forms the NAI value with the domain name stored in a memory of the dual-mode terminal in advance by the IMSI. The dual-mode terminal extracts a RAND that is necessary for the calculation of an authentication parameters from the Random values included in a Chap Challenge message, instructs the R-UIM card to use the CAVE algorithm to calculate the authentication parameters with the RAND and an exsiting SSD_A in the R-UIM card, and bears the authentication parameters by the Result domain of a Chap Response message. With the present invention, the wastes caused by the replacement of R-UIM cards can be avoided.

Abstract: A method for Access Authentication in the High Rate Packet Data Network is proposed in the present invention comprising steps of the AN-AAA receiving the Radius Access Request message sent from the HRPD AN; the AN-AAA judging whether a terminal is a roaming one according to the Network Access ID and transmits the roaming terminal's authentication information to the terminal's home nerwork. If said terminal is a local one, the AN-AAA judges the type of the terminal according to the NAI value. If said terminal is a single-mode one, the AN-AAA works out the Result2 with the MD5 algorithm. if said terminal is in dual-mode, the AN-AAA calculates the Result2 with the CAVE algorithm to compare the Result1 with the Result2.

Abstract: A method for managing a pattern object file in a modular test system is disclosed. The method includes providing a modular test system, where the modular test system comprises a system controller for controlling at least one site controller, and where the at least one site controller controls at least one test module and its corresponding device under test (DUT). The method further includes creating an object file management framework for establishing a standard interface between vendor-supplied pattern compilers and the modular test system, receiving a pattern source file, creating a pattern object metafile based on the pattern source file using the object file management framework, and testing the device under test through the test module using the pattern object metafile.

Abstract: The nail clipper contains a pair of blade bodies each having a cutting edge, a lever to be operated for bringing the cutting edges of the blade bodies into press contact with each other and a supporting shaft for linking the lever to the blade bodies; the cutting edges of the blade bodies being brought into press contact with each other by pressing the blade bodies with the lever against resilience of the blade bodies. The nail clipper is provided with bosses formed either on the lever or on the supporting shaft, so as to allow the supporting shaft to pivotally support the lever; and grooves formed on the rest of the supporting shaft and the lever, with which the bosses are engaged. Each groove has a mouth portion through which the boss is engaged and disengaged, a guiding portion capable of pivotally supporting the boss, and a connecting portion connecting the mouth portion and the guiding portion to each other.
Abstract: An edge 3 extending from a body 2 includes a plurality of recesses 4 and a plurality of projections 5, which are alternately formed in a continuous manner. The edge 3 also includes a plurality of projecting edge sections 6, each of which extends at distal and basal sides with respect to the tip of a corresponding one of the projections 5. Each projecting edge section 6 includes a distal slanted edge section 7 and a basal slanted edge section 8, which are connected to each other at the tip of the corresponding projection 5. The shape of each distal slanted edge section 7 is different from the shape of each basal slanted edge section 8.
Abstract: A razor handle includes a hard section and a soft section integrally formed and overlapping each other. On the rear surface of a gripping section, a second rear contact section of the soft section is exposed and a finger applying concave section is formed at the upper section of the second rear contact section. On the front surface of the gripping section, the first front contact section of the hard section is exposed at the boundary section with a side surface, the second front contact section of the soft section is exposed between the first front contact sections at the both boundary sections, and a concave area is formed on the upper section of the second front contact section.
Abstract: The method for distinguishing the MBMS service request from the other service request comprising steps of: sending a message to a UE by a RNC to indicate that the UE needs a RRC or a PS domain connection; sending a message to a SGSN by the UE to indicate it requires MBMS service or dedicated service; and sending different messages to the RNC by the SGSN according to the different service types or messages. This invention can make the SGSN correctly distinguish service requests initiated by different services and then adopt different operations on different service requests accordingly. This kind of differentiated operation can make the SGSN send different signaling to the RNC, which makes the RNC count the number of UEs accurately and avoid the waste of radio resources.

Abstract: A blade sharpener for grinding a kitchen knife, etc. in which two separate rotary shafts are provided in parallel, at least one whetstone is mounted on each one of the rotary shafts, the circumferential surface of the whetstone forms a grinding surface, the whetstone on one rotary shaft and the whetstone on the other rotary shaft are positionally shifted in the axial direction of the rotary shafts, and the cutting edge of the blade of kitchen knife is ground by moving the blade in the axial direction of the rotary shafts while applying the cutting edge to the grinding surfaces of the whetstones.
Abstract: A near-field optical probe has a cantilever formed of a transparent material and having a first main surface and a second main surface opposite the first main surface. A base supports the cantilever at the first main surface. A tip extends from the second main surface of the cantilever and has a microscopic aperture at an end thereof. The tip is formed of a transparent material having a higher refractive index than that of the transparent material of the cantilever to increase an amount of near-field light generated or detected by the microscopic aperture. A shade film is formed on the second main surface of the cantilever and on a surface of the tip except for the microscopic aperture.
